Web25 sep. 2024 · Malawi’s adult literacy rate, defined as the “percentage of people 15 and above who can both read and write with understanding a short simple statement about everyday life,” was 64 percent in 1998. Unfortunately, the adult literacy rate had declined to 62 percent by 2015, the most recent year for which figures are available.

We work with 10 public primary schools to improve the literacy levels of more than 4,000 children and … WebMalawi it has, according publishes UNESCO, an adult literacy rate of 62.14%. While the male literacy rate is 69.75%, for females is 55.2%, showing a big gap between the sexes. In comparison with other countries is number 130º in the ranking of literacy rate. The literacy rate,has dropped in recent years. Here we show you literacy rate in Malawi.
